Using the listening modes Input sources and listening modes The available listening modes vary depending on the input source. The following table shows each input source and the available listening modes. *Available for TX-DS676. The available listening modes vary depending on the input signal. • The table shown above lists the input sources and listening modes available when the speakers are installed in a full configuration (right/left front, center, and right/left surround speakers).Without surround speakers, set the listening mode to "STEREO (3 Stereo)" or "Direct." 37
